    Medicine Description

    Flumetol Eye Drops is an ophthalmic preparation used to relieve inflammation and redness in the eye. This drop contains the active ingredient fluorometholone at a concentration of 0.1%. This medication provides targeted treatment for many inflammatory conditions affecting different parts of the eye, helping to restore comfort and normal function.

    What are the ingredients in Flumetol?

    Flumetol Eye Drops contain the following active ingredient:

    Fluorometholone: ​​0.1%.

    In addition to this active ingredient, the drop contains inactive ingredients that make up the ophthalmic preparation.

    Indications for Use

    Flumetol Eye Drops are used to treat:

    Allergic eye infections: such as allergic conjunctivitis.

    Non-infectious eye infections: such as blepharitis, non-infectious conjunctivitis, or keratitis.

    Post-surgical eye infections: to reduce inflammation and swelling.

    Treatment aims to relieve inflammation, redness, and itching in the eye.

    What are the dosages of Flumetol?

    Flumetol eye drops should be used as directed by a specialist physician. The dosage and duration of treatment depend on the severity of the condition and the patient's response.

    The usual adult dosage is one to two drops in the affected eye 2-4 times daily. In severe cases, the dosage may be increased in the first few days and then gradually reduced.

    Wash your hands thoroughly before using the drops.

    Avoid touching the tip of the dropper to the eye or any other surface to prevent contamination.

    Replace the dropper cap tightly after use.

    Do not use the drops for extended periods without consulting a physician, especially to avoid side effects associated with prolonged use of corticosteroids in the eye.

    What are the side effects of Flumetol?

    Flumetol eye drops may cause some side effects, especially with prolonged use:

    Common side effects (topical):

    Mild burning or temporary stinging when applying the drops.

    Temporary blurred vision.
